Nutrition also plays a vital role in the Flexigenics program. Proper nutrition supports joint health and flexibility by ensuring that the body receives the necessary vitamins and minerals. Omega-3 fatty acids, for instance, have been shown to reduce inflammation, while antioxidants can help combat oxidative stress that leads to joint issues. Flexigenics encourages individuals to incorporate anti-inflammatory foods, such as fatty fish, leafy greens, and nuts, into their diet, further enhancing the efficacy of the movement routines.
